Richmond Park Golf Course has 18 holes set amidst 100 acres of well-established parkland, with the River Wissey meandering through its fairways. Designed and developed in 1990 it has been constructed to high specifications, providing a demanding but not daunting total yardage of 6,258 with a par of 71. Maintenance of the course is to the highest of standards and a driving range with covered bays and a practice putting green are also available for golfers. The distinctive, colonial style clubhouse extends a very real welcome, offering restaurant facilities and the club bar which overlooks the course.

The golf apartments at Richmond Park provide luxurious accommodation within the golf complex. Fully equipped to the highest of standards, they offer the full range of home comforts in spaciously comfortable surroundings. The apartments range in size from one to two bedrooms, each with living room, kitchen, toilet and shower or bath. Utilisation of a bed settee in each lounge makes a total sleeping accommodation for between four and six people. All accommodation is self-catering. The village of Watton is one mile from Richmond Park and has a good selection of pubs and restaurants!
